@charset "utf-8";
/*main*/
#goods figure, .main p {
  text-align: center;
}
figcaption {
  font-size: 1.2rem;
}
figure img {
  margin-bottom: 10px;
}
.main p:nth-of-type(1) {
  font-size: 2rem;
  color: #e42e33;
  margin-bottom: 30px;
}
.main p:last-of-type span {
  display: block;
}
.main p:last-of-type {
  font-size: 1.4rem;
  margin-bottom: 90px;
}
.goods1 figure {
  margin-bottom: 30px;
}
.goods1 img {
  width: 84.1%;
}
.goods2 {
  display: flex;
  justify-content: center;
  margin: 0 auto 30px;
}
.goods2 img {
  width: 100%;
}
.goods2 figure:first-child {
  padding: 0 10px 0 34px;
}
.goods2 figure:nth-child(2) {
  padding: 0 34px 0 10px;
}
@media screen and (min-width:961px) {
  .goods1 img {
    max-width: 720px;
  }
  .goods2 img {
    max-width: 340px;
  }
  figcaption {
    font-size: 1rem;
  }
}
/*/main*/